在时间的长河中,钟表不仅是记录时间的工具,更是人类智慧的结晶。它以简洁的线条和精确的刻度,见证了历史的变迁,也承载了艺术的美感。今天,让我们通过数学创意画,一起探索钟表的奥秘,感受时间与艺术的奇妙融合。
数学与钟表的邂逅
钟表的设计与制作,离不开数学的支撑。从圆形表盘到刻度,从指针到齿轮,每一个细节都蕴含着数学的智慧。
圆形表盘的秘密
钟表的表盘通常是圆形的,这是因为圆形具有均匀分布的特点,使得时间的流逝更加直观。数学上,圆形的周长与直径之间存在固定的比例关系,即π(圆周率)。在创意画中,我们可以通过绘制圆形,来表现时间的无限循环。
刻度的艺术
钟表的刻度分为时针、分针和秒针,它们分别代表小时、分钟和秒钟。在数学创意画中,我们可以通过不同的线条粗细和长度,来区分不同时间的刻度,让画面更加生动。
创意画中的钟表
将数学与钟表相结合,创作出富有创意的画作,既能展示时间的流逝,又能表达艺术的魅力。
圆形分割法
我们可以将圆形表盘分割成若干等分,每一份代表一个时间单位。在创意画中,通过绘制不同颜色的分割线,来区分不同的时间区域。
import matplotlib.pyplot as plt
# 设置圆形分割的份数
n = 60
# 绘制圆形
theta = np.linspace(0, 2 * np.pi, n)
x = np.cos(theta)
y = np.sin(theta)
# 绘制分割线
for i in range(1, n):
plt.plot([x[i], x[i-1]], [y[i], y[i-1]], color='black')
plt.gca().set_aspect('equal', adjustable='box')
plt.show()
齿轮与指针
在创意画中,我们可以绘制齿轮和指针,来表现钟表的运行原理。通过不同的齿轮组合,可以实现时间的精确计算。
# 绘制齿轮
def draw_gear(radius, teeth):
theta = np.linspace(0, 2 * np.pi, teeth)
x = radius * np.cos(theta)
y = radius * np.sin(theta)
return x, y
# 绘制指针
def draw_pointer(length, angle):
x = length * np.cos(angle)
y = length * np.sin(angle)
return x, y
# 设置齿轮参数
radius = 1
teeth = 20
# 绘制齿轮
gear_x, gear_y = draw_gear(radius, teeth)
# 设置指针参数
length = 0.5
angle = np.pi / 2 # 90度
# 绘制指针
pointer_x, pointer_y = draw_pointer(length, angle)
# 绘制图形
plt.plot(gear_x, gear_y, 'o')
plt.plot([0, pointer_x], [0, pointer_y], 'r--')
plt.gca().set_aspect('equal', adjustable='box')
plt.show()
时间与艺术的融合
数学创意画不仅展示了钟表的奥秘,更将时间与艺术完美融合。在创作过程中,我们可以发挥自己的想象力,将钟表元素融入各种艺术形式,如绘画、雕塑、摄影等。
绘画艺术
在绘画艺术中,我们可以通过绘制钟表元素,来表达时间的流逝和人生的变迁。例如,绘制一幅以钟表为主题的油画,可以让人感受到时间的永恒和生命的短暂。
雕塑艺术
在雕塑艺术中,我们可以将钟表的齿轮和指针进行夸张处理,创作出富有创意的作品。例如,将齿轮设计成动物或植物的形状,让作品更具趣味性。
摄影艺术
在摄影艺术中,我们可以利用钟表元素,来表现时间的流逝和光影的变化。例如,拍摄一幅以钟表为主题的延时摄影作品,可以展示时间的流转和自然界的美丽。
通过数学创意画,我们不仅探索了钟表的奥秘,更感受到了时间与艺术的奇妙融合。在今后的日子里,让我们用创意和智慧,继续探索这个充满魅力的世界。
